Q: Is 864,426 a Prime Number?
A: No, 864,426 is not a prime number.
A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.
The number 864426 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 144,071 288,142 432,213 and 864,426, with no remainder.
Since 864,426 cannot be divided by just 1 and 864,426, it is not a prime number.
